Abstract
The authors describe the implementation of explicit vector operations for a series of high level language compilers (C, Pascal and FORTRAN) for DSP processors, and illustrate their application with an example of real time adaptive filtering at audio frequencies, written in Pascal. They also propose a further useful extension through the use of explicit `array´ operations (that is operators whose effect is between whole arrays of data rather than between individual samples)
